C133 ASL is a 1985 Fiat Ducato in White with a 1,971c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 30 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 56.7%.
Across all 1985 Fiat Ducato models, the average MOT pass rate is 62.8% with a typical mileage of 75,717 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Fiat Ducato fails its MOT is wind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ively, accounting for 34,174 recorded failures. If you're considering buying C133 ASL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Ducato typically stays on UK roads for around 38 years. At 41 years old, this Fiat Ducato is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
